After the trade period, we have picks 12, 52, 88, 106, ... and now require a minimum 2 players to add to our senior list (to reach at least 38 senior-listed players).

One of these will be Lambert when he is promoted off the rookie list and the other pick 12. So, if I've got this right, we would need to delist one of more of Dea, Lloyd and Gordon) to use pick(s) 52 or higher.

What are we gonna find at picks 88+? Another couple of guys 4-5 years off who are 50 shades of poo away from ever being good enough to get a game
That will be the Club's view as far as the draft from their comments in the past. We could also, as Diocletian alluded to, delist one or more of Dea, Gordon or Lloyd, if we still plan to bring in a delisted free agent.
